*D*.R. Horton, Inc., the largest homebuilder in the U.S.** , was founded in 1978 and is a publicly traded company on the New York Stock Exchange. It is engaged in the construction and sale of high quality homes designed principally for the entry-level and first time move-up markets. The Company also provides mortgage financing and title services for homebuyers through its mortgage and title subsidiaries. Please visit our website at www.drhorton.com for more information.

D.R. Horton, Inc. is currently looking for a Contracts Attorney for their Legal Department. The right candidate will review and negotiate a wide range of complex commercial transactions and agreements, including vendor agreements as well as provide legal guidance and support concerning vendor transactions, legal risks within contractual agreements and other issues that arise.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

  • Provide legal advice in connection with vendor agreements, including professional services agreements, independent contractor and subcontractor agreements, master services agreements, purchase and supply agreements, non-disclosure agreements and other vendor and commercial agreements
  • Draft, review, and negotiate complex commercial transactions with vendors, suppliers, service providers and other counterparties
  • Provide practical, business-oriented guidance on risk allocation, limitation of liability, indemnity, security obligations, and other legal and business risks presented by vendor transactions
  • Interact daily with personnel across the company, including procurement, financial services, real estate, risk management and other business teams, regarding a broad array of contracting and compliance issues including those typically encountered in the home building industry and the mortgage and title businesses
  • Manage and prioritize multiple projects; analyze business and legal risks presented by these projects, coordinate with appropriate stakeholders; and bring these projects to a successful conclusion
  • Develop and maintain contract templates, playbooks, standard terms, policies and procedures to reflect current law and business needs
  • Conduct all business in a professional and ethical manner to serve customers and increase the goodwill and profit of the company
